ESPN's latest prediction is that the Warriors have 51 wins and 31 losses in the regular season, ranking third in the Western Conference, second only to the Thunder and Nuggets. This has made many fans wonder: "38-year-old Curry, 37-year-old Butler, 36-year-old Dream Green, plus 39-year-old Horford, why is this sunset red team so optimistic?"

Peter believes that the Warriors ranking third in the Western Conference is still very reliable.

First, Butler + Curry, as long as they work together for a full season, they are guaranteed to be top 6 in the Western Conference!

Last season, Butler came to the Warriors and played for half a season, achieving 24 wins and 8 losses, allowing the Warriors to jump from 12th in the Western Conference to seventh in the Western Conference. At the same time, during the period when Curry and Butler teamed up, his scoring average soared to only 28.2 points, and his three-point shooting percentage reached 41.4%!

This season, as Butler said, I just figured out all the terminology of the Warriors system. This means that if these two play together for one season, they can really guarantee the top 6 in the Western Conference!

Second, Curry has become the biggest beneficiary of the league's new regulations

In today's preseason, Curry played 26 minutes and scored 13 free throws. This is the impact of the new regulations. Throughout his career, Curry's shot violations have always been ignored by referees. Curry will only become more of a threat next season!

Third, the depth of the lineup is much stronger than last season

The 39-year-old Horford, the most intelligent space big man in the league at the moment, allows Dream Green to return to his best position at the fourth position, and his arrival also allows the Warriors to adopt a 5-out strategy and a richer system.

In addition, the additions of Melton and Seth Curry will increase the bench's three-point shooting firepower, while Moody and Kuminga will also become the team's X factor.

So, with these three advantages, there should be nothing wrong with the Warriors ranking third in the Western Conference.
